### Account recovery — Tollgate session bug

If the Tollgate refresh bug invalidates admin sessions, do not reset the IdP. Use the recovery account on the Marnix bastion. Verify the audit log shows no refresh loop first. Unlock the recovery account with the passphrase stored directly below this line.

strongbox words: gilok-druion-briath-wendor-briion-prawyn-fenion-oliir-casdor-holius-briius-gilath-gilael-pelys

## v4.8.0 — Changed defaults

Sheetforge export now streams rows instead of buffering whole workbooks in memory. Peak RSS on large exports dropped from ~6 GB to ~400 MB in staging. Default chunk size is 5,000 rows; the old buffered path is gone, so don't look for the flag. Exports over 1M rows now require the streaming writer. The new defaults ship as follows below.

service settings:
PRAIX_LOG_LEVEL=error
PRAIX_METRICS_HOST=metrics.praix.qorvelcorp.corp
PRAIX_POOL_SIZE=16

### Autoscaler ignores queue depth

If your Loadmere plugin reports depth but no scaling occurs, the metrics push is likely unauthenticated. The autoscaler silently drops unauthorized samples rather than erroring. Verify your plugin posts to the staging collector first, then production. Each push must include the bearer token that follows.

session JWT of yawep-yawep = eyJhbGciOiJIUzI1NiIsInR5cCI6IkpXVCJ9.eyJzdWIiOiI3pWF3_In0.aXYsHiog